After months of drawn out ARG, missing the ideal announcement day of Dia de los Muertos, Blizzard opened BlizzCon by announcing Sombra. A Mexican hacker with a machine pistol and the ability to go invisible, teleport, and disable other hero’s abilities. She should hit the Test Server this Tuesday and be along in the main game later this month.Not only will the Necromancer be returning to Diablo 3, but Blizzard is also remaking Diablo 1, bringing in a filter to restore the grainy look of D1, and the option to use 8 directional movement.
